Ticket: Prototype workshop, Level B1, Farrow Annex. The Veltrix team reports the workshop door latch is sticking and the badge reader intermittently rejects valid passes. Facilities will service it Thursday morning. Until then, reception should direct approved workshop visitors to the side entrance and sign them in manually. Anyone needing access before the repair should be given the temporary door code below.

door code, tahop-fahap: bdg-JZCXMY-37375484

Ticket: missed pick-up, Wednesday afternoon. The printed interpretation labels for the new Tidewater Gallery were boxed and ready at reception by 2 p.m., but the courier from Merrow Express never arrived, and no call was logged. The opening is in nine days, so the framers at Calloway Mounts need these urgently. Please rebook for tomorrow's first slot and note the hand-over instruction for the courier directly below.

handover note for yagef-bagep: the drudor pelius courier leaves the kasdor zorvan norir ledger at gate 8016 under passcode 755406

Management Meeting Minutes — Finance Distribution

Attendees: R. Calloway, M. Ostrander, J. Bel.

1. Sole reliance on Kestrel Moldings flagged as risk after June delays.
2. Ostrander to shortlist three second-source candidates by month end.
3. Qualification budget capped at 40k pending board sign-off.
4. Tooling duplication costs to be modeled separately.

Next review in four weeks. Note the following before the shortlist circulates.

management briefing: The renewal with Zoraelax Group closes at $10 million a year, 15 percent below the last contract. Project Ralael slips by six weeks because of the audit delay.